Autonomous robots drive in the Jihlava Hospital thanks to T-Mobile's 5G network  

The Jihlava Hospital is the first in the Czech Republic to put into operation six autonomous robots, which, thanks to the connection via the 5G network, will speed up operations and relieve the work of staff. Four of them independently deliver food through underground corridors, publicly accessible areas, to the end wards to patients. Other robots are used by the hospital for cleaning. The system is also ready for future use in transporting medical supplies throughout the premises.

The robots operate thanks to an ultra-fast and reliable 5G network that ensures safe operation and precise control in a demanding hospital environment. Logistics robots are already in full operation, transporting transport cabinets with food either directly on top of each other or in the pulling mode of a connected train. Fully autonomous washing robots are also part of the solution. Thanks to the infrastructure and the robots deployed, a unique, fully automated and comprehensive operating system has been created at the Jihlava Hospital, which increases efficiency and ensures the self-sufficiency of logistics. 

The technology of autonomous mobile robots is provided for the operation of the hospital by the general contractor of the project, ServisControl. The project is financed by the European Union, which is part of the National Recovery Plan and is carried out with the support of the Ministry of Regional Development of the Czech Republic. The partner in the construction of the 5G network is T-Mobile, which participates in the implementation as a supplier of the so-called hybrid 5G network. It combines the features of a public mobile network, such as wide coverage, but also offers a special dedicated part of the network that is completely separated and protected for the specific needs of a particular operation. "This is crucial for autonomous robots because they require fast and reliable real-time communication in order to work safely and efficiently without interruption. Thanks to it, their complete communication with all infrastructure, including elevators, door openings and traffic lights – with minimal response and high reliability is ensured," says Ing. Jakub Kopecký, Tribe Lead for Industry 4.0 at T-Mobile.

The implementation also included the modernization of the elevator in cooperation with the company VÝTAHY VANĚRKA and also the modification of the automatically opening doors by Raccoon. All this infrastructure was then integrated into the control system of ServisControl. The total investment in the technology is CZK 19,713,000 excluding VAT.
